We did the Portage/Endeavor transition on Sunday. My son and I were flying a couple slower airplanes, that couldn't maintain 90 knots. I had a Grumman overtake us, passing about 100 foot above us. I didn't see him until he appeared in the top of my windshield. There were a few others that passed us, but they passed to the side with plenty of clearance. Someone if the flight behind us almost got run over by one of the Aeroshell T6's. He exited the runway at a high rate of speed in his Thorp T-18. I think some of the controllers had some issues this year.
